A student scored a 98, 86, 93 and 75 in math for the quarter. What is the student's math average for the quarter?

Add all the grades and divide by the number of grades. The answer is 88.

98+86+93+75=352

352/4=88

The math average is 88.

1. Find the percent markup.

Markup ($) = percent markup (%) x original cost ($)

A computer store buys a laptop for $635 directly from the manufacturer (Dell). The markup is $570. What is the percent markup on the computer?

The percent markup is: <u> </u><u>90</u><u> </u>%

\mathbb{ \ \underline{ \:  \:  SOLUTION    : }}

FORMULA: Percent of Markup = Markup/Cost x 100

  • = $570/$635 x 100
  • = 0.90 x 100
  • = 90%
